McCollum scored 25 points and Walker added 21, as the Hawks defeated the Nets 141-107.

The Hawks defeated the Nets 141-107. McCollum contributed 25 points, 2 rebounds, and 7 assists, while Walker added 21 points, 4 rebounds, and 3 assists. For the Nets, Claxton had 16 points, 5 rebounds, and 2 assists, and Smith had 15 points and 2 rebounds.
In the first quarter, the Hawks started with a 10-0 run to establish a lead, firing on all cylinders both inside and outside, at one point leading by 17 points. The Nets managed only sporadic scoring to close the gap, and the Hawks led 35-25 at the end of the first quarter. In the second quarter, the Nets narrowed the gap to single digits, but the Hawks relied on consecutive scores from Walker and McCollum to stabilize the situation. At halftime, the Hawks led 71-55.
After switching sides, the Nets briefly narrowed the gap, but the Hawks, relying on McCollum and his teammates' continued output, maintained a double-digit lead. At the end of the third quarter, the Hawks led 98-85. In the final quarter, the Hawks exploded, hitting consecutive three-pointers to quickly widen the gap to over 30 points, effectively ending any suspense in the game. Ultimately, the Hawks defeated the Nets 141-107.
Hawks player statistics
McCollum 25 points, 2 rebounds, 7 assists; Walker 21 points, 4 rebounds, 3 assists; Johnson 18 points, 11 rebounds, 5 assists; Okongwu 15 points, 7 rebounds, 4 assists; Kispert 13 points, 2 rebounds, 1 assist; Kuminga 12 points, 2 rebounds, 1 assist; Daniels 11 points, 4 rebounds, 6 assists; Gay 5 points, 4 rebounds, 1 assist
Nets player statistics
Claxton had 16 points, 5 rebounds, and 2 assists; Smith had 15 points and 2 rebounds; Traore had 13 points, 2 rebounds, and 4 assists; Klonny had 12 points, 4 rebounds, and 1 assist; Johnson had 11 points, 6 rebounds, and 4 assists; Minott had 10 points and 3 rebounds; Williams had 8 points, 3 rebounds, and 3 assists; Mann had 8 points, 2 rebounds, and 1 assist.
